Output e8fa0a0eaf836f8de31cd81ae1d82386b69641d2f7453ebf422b8d8109efc10d: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ff38d4713d6c1f9e1dd3d67300d0effee6697b0 OP_EQUAL
address
3Btxh7kdSdTptP3HVPtrgMdVpDmbB8yKYe
transaction
e8fa0a0eaf836f8de31cd81ae1d82386b69641d2f7453ebf422b8d8109efc10d